Excel Template for University Scholarship Application Records

-

Excel templates for university scholarship application records typically contain structured data regarding applicant information, scholarship criteria, and application status, facilitating easy tracking and management. These documents help universities organize and evaluate scholarship applications efficiently.

  1. Include columns for applicant details such as name, ID, contact information, and academic qualifications.
  2. Track application statuses with clear labels like submitted, under review, approved, or rejected.
  3. Incorporate filters and formulas to rank applicants based on eligibility and academic performance.

Excel Dashboard for Tracking Annual Scholarship Applications

-

An Excel dashboard for tracking annual scholarship applications is a visual tool used to monitor and analyze the progress and status of scholarship submissions throughout the year. It consolidates data into a concise, easy-to-interpret format for efficient decision-making and reporting.

Key features to include are:

  1. Summary statistics such as total applications, approvals, and pending reviews.
  2. Visual charts illustrating application trends and demographic breakdowns.
  3. Filters and slicers for dynamic data exploration by criteria like date, program, or applicant status.
